Abstract

The utility model belongs to the technical field of household appliances, and particularly discloses an electric box assembly and an air conditioner, wherein the electric box assembly comprises: the electrical appliance box comprises an electrical appliance box shell and a cover, wherein the electrical appliance box shell comprises a box body and an end cover, a hollow cavity is formed in the box body, the end cover is in waterproof fit with the box body, a PCB is arranged in the cavity, and the box body is provided with a light transmission part which is used for displaying information of a communication port circuit arranged at the bottom of the PCB; the bottom of the PCB is provided with a dial switch and a key, and the light-transmitting part is used for directly operating the dial switch and performing combined operation of the key and the dial switch under the condition that a motor is not detached. The utility model has the advantages of providing the electric appliance box shell with the end cover with good sealing performance and convenient assembly and disassembly, being convenient to set an address, being convenient to observe the running state of the motor and being capable of locally controlling the running of the motor.

具体地,指示输出为指示灯42的闪烁次数,运行状态信息包括电机的转速、功率、电流或/和电压,一般来说,电机的运行状态是通过程序去定义并配合硬件电路去实现的,控制电机运行状态的程序是通过针座41也可以称为外接端子进行烧录下载进电机主控芯片,针座41作为一个传递转接装置是将外部程序与电机内部程序通信的桥梁。通信接口模块能够根据运行状态信息判断电机的故障情况并控制指示灯42的闪烁,在本实施例中,指示灯42通过闪烁状态来表示电机的故障状态,举例来说,指示灯42的闪烁次数与故障状态的对应关系设置如下:1:指示灯42闪烁2次:直流母线过压(超过400V)保护;2:指示灯42闪烁3次:直流母线欠压(低于170V) 保护,3:指示灯42闪烁4次:三相过流保护,4:指示灯42闪烁5次:功率保护,5:指示灯42闪烁6次:缺相保护,6:指示灯42闪烁7次:FO 硬件过流保护,7:指示灯42闪烁8次:偏置电压出错保护,8:指示灯42 闪烁9次:失速保护,9:指示灯42闪烁10次:失步保护,10:指示灯42 持续进行闪烁即无数次:输入频率信号超出范围;因此,用户通过观察指示灯42的闪烁状态就可以方便地了解电机的运行状态,更优的是,端盖3 采用透明材质,则无需打开端盖3就可以观察到指示灯42的工作状态,更加方便快捷。Specifically, the indicated output is the number of flashes of the indicator light 42, and the operating state information includes the rotational speed, power, current or/and voltage of the motor. Generally speaking, the operating state of the motor is defined by the program and realized with the hardware circuit, The program to control the running state of the motor is programmed and downloaded into the main control chip of the motor through the needle seat 41, which can also be called an external terminal. The communication interface module can judge the fault condition of the motor and control the flashing of the indicator light 42 according to the operating status information. In this embodiment, the indicator light 42 indicates the fault status of the motor by the flashing state. For example, the flashing times of the indicator light 42 The corresponding relationship with the fault state is set as follows: 1: Indicator light 42 flashes twice: DC bus overvoltage (over 400V) protection; 2: Indicator light 42 flashes three times: DC bus undervoltage (below 170V) protection, 3: The indicator light 42 flashes 4 times: three-phase overcurrent protection, 4: the indicator light 42 flashes 5 times: power protection, 5: the indicator light 42 flashes 6 times: phase loss protection, 6: the indicator light 42 flashes 7 times: FO hardware over Current protection, 7: indicator light 42 flashes 8 times: bias voltage error protection, 8: indicator light 42 flashes 9 times: stall protection, 9: indicator light 42 flashes 10 times: out-of-step protection, 10: indicator light 42 continues Blinking means innumerable times: the input frequency signal is out of range; therefore, the user can easily understand the running state of the motor by observing the blinking state of the indicator light 42. What is even better is that the end cover 3 is made of transparent material, so there is no need to open the end cover 3 The working state of the indicator light 42 can be observed, which is more convenient and quicker.

重点参考图6和图8,优选地,拨码开关43包括均具有开状态和关状态的第一开关431和第二开关432,PCB板4包括与拨码开关43电连接的地址编码模块,地址编码模块根据拨码开关43的开关信息确定控制器的地址,控制器的地址就是PCB板4装进电器盒壳体后,组成一个整体,此时电器盒组件的地址就是控制器的地址,单独一个电器盒组件不装配PCB板 4时,电器盒组件属于一个硬件结构,不具备通信作用,即不具有通信地址,该控制器的地址可以用于匹配对应模式来进行通信。通过拨动第一开关431和第二开关432获得不同开关状态组合来确定控制器具有不同地址,在本实施例中,采用两个指示灯42通过两者具有的四个不同开关状态组合能够设置四个不同地址,举例来说,两个拨码开关43的不同开关状态组合与设置的具体地址的对应关系如下:1:在第一开关431和第二开关432都处于OFF位置时,控制器设为地址1;2:在第一开关431处于ON、第二开关432处于OFF时,控制器设为于地址2;3:在第一开关431处于 OFF、第二开关432处于ON时,控制器设为地址3;在第一开关431和第二开关432都处于ON时,控制器设为地址4。因此,当需要对控制器进行设置地址时,无需拆开整个电机或电器盒,只需打开端盖3就可以通过操作拨码开关43来设置,极大地降低了操作复杂性和减小了操作难度,而且,采用拨码开关43不仅减少使用个数且设置相对简单快捷。6 and 8, preferably, the DIP switch 43 includes a first switch 431 and a second switch 432 each having an ON state and an OFF state, and the PCB board 4 includes an address coding module electrically connected to the DIP switch 43, The address coding module determines the address of the controller according to the switch information of the DIP switch 43. The address of the controller is the address of the controller after the PCB board 4 is installed into the housing of the electrical box. At this time, the address of the electrical box assembly is the address of the controller. When a single electrical box component is not assembled with the PCB board 4, the electrical box component belongs to a hardware structure and does not have a communication function, that is, it does not have a communication address, and the address of the controller can be used to match the corresponding mode for communication. It is determined that the controller has different addresses by toggling the first switch 431 and the second switch 432 to obtain different switch state combinations. In this embodiment, two indicator lights 42 are used to set four different switch state combinations. Four different addresses, for example, the corresponding relationship between the different switch state combinations of the two DIP switches 43 and the specific addresses set are as follows: 1: When the first switch 431 and the second switch 432 are both in the OFF position, the controller Set to address 1; 2: When the first switch 431 is ON and the second switch 432 is OFF, the controller is set to address 2; 3: When the first switch 431 is OFF and the second switch 432 is ON, the controller controls The controller is set to address 3; when the first switch 431 and the second switch 432 are both ON, the controller is set to address 4. Therefore, when it is necessary to set the address of the controller, it is not necessary to disassemble the entire motor or electrical box, just open the end cover 3 to set the address by operating the DIP switch 43, which greatly reduces the complexity of the operation and the operation. Difficulty, and the use of the DIP switch 43 not only reduces the number of use but also is relatively simple and quick to set up.

重点参考图7和图8,具体地,控制键44包括第一按键441和第二按键442,第一按键441、第二按键442、第一开关431和第二开关432共同被操作以确定本地运行信息来供本地控制模块接收,第一开关431和第二开关432的不同开关状态组合用于确定电机的转向、转速或/和功率,第一按键441和第二按键442分别用于确定电机的转速的增加和减小或者分别用于确定电机的启动和暂停,因此,在上述第一开关431和第二开关432起到设置电器盒的地址的基础上,该两开关还能与两按键共同作用达到对电机本地运行状态的控制,在本实施例中,各开关及各按键的四个不同操作组合能够控制电机的四个不同本地运行状态,举例来说,各个拨码开关43和各个按键的不同操作组合与四个不同本地运行状态的对应关系如下:1:第一开关431位于ON、第二开关432位于OFF时,电机处于正转模式,第一按键控制加速,第二按键控制减速;2:第一开关431位于OFF、第二开关 432位于ON时,电机处于反转模式,第一按键控制加速,第二按键控制减速;3:第一开关431、第二开关432同时位于ON时,电机处于最大转速运转(即系统允许最大转速1500rpm),第一按键控制启动,第二按键控制暂停;4:第一开关431、第二开关432同时位于OFF时,电机处于最大功率运转(即系统允许最大功率1500W),1号按键控制启动,2号按键控制暂停。7 and 8, specifically, the control key 44 includes a first key 441 and a second key 442, the first key 441, the second key 442, the first switch 431 and the second switch 432 are jointly operated to determine the local The operation information is received by the local control module. The different switch states of the first switch 431 and the second switch 432 are used to determine the rotation, speed or/and power of the motor. The first button 441 and the second button 442 are used to determine the motor. The increase and decrease of the speed of the electric motor are respectively used to determine the start and pause of the motor. Therefore, on the basis that the above-mentioned first switch 431 and second switch 432 play the role of setting the address of the electrical box, the two switches can also be combined with the two buttons. The joint action achieves the control of the local running state of the motor. In this embodiment, four different operation combinations of each switch and each button can control four different local running states of the motor. For example, each DIP switch 43 and each The corresponding relationship between the different operation combinations of the buttons and the four different local operating states is as follows: 1: When the first switch 431 is ON and the second switch 432 is OFF, the motor is in forward rotation mode, the first button controls acceleration, and the second button controls Deceleration; 2: When the first switch 431 is OFF and the second switch 432 is ON, the motor is in reverse mode, the first button controls acceleration, and the second button controls deceleration; 3: The first switch 431 and the second switch 432 are simultaneously in When ON, the motor is running at the maximum speed (that is, the maximum speed allowed by the system is 1500rpm), the first button controls the start, and the second button controls the pause; 4: When the first switch 431 and the second switch 432 are both OFF, the motor is running at the maximum power (That is, the maximum power allowed by the system is 1500W), the No. 1 button controls the start, and the No. 2 button controls the pause.
